North America and Europe Lead the Global Intraoperative Radiation Therapy Market Amid Growing Clinical Adoption

0
407

The global intraoperative radiation therapy (IORT) market, valued at USD 322.67 million in 2024, is projected to expand at a CAGR of 7.27% between 2025 and 2034, driven by regional advancements in oncological treatment systems, healthcare infrastructure modernization, and the growing prevalence of cancer worldwide. The steady rise in breast, colorectal, and pancreatic cancer cases—combined with technological innovations in radiation precision and dose management—continues to reinforce the market’s strategic relevance. As regional manufacturing trends and healthcare spending vary across North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ific, the market’s structure is being increasingly shaped by policy frameworks, reimbursement dynamics, and the integration of clinical radiation solutions across tertiary healthcare centers.

In North America, the U.S. remains the primary revenue contributor, supported by advanced oncology treatment networks, strong reimbursement systems, and ongoing clinical trials sponsored by leading cancer centers. According to the National Cancer Institute, over 1.9 million new cancer cases were diagnosed in the U.S. in 2024, emphasizing the urgent need for localized and intraoperative radiation modalities. Hospitals across the region are accelerating adoption due to the ability of IORT to deliver concentrated radiation directly to tumor sites during surgery, reducing recurrence rates and shortening treatment cycles. Cross-border supply chains between the U.S. and Canada further strengthen equipment availability, while partnerships between device manufacturers and hospital systems have improved service penetration and clinical efficacy.

In Europe, strong regulatory support from the European Medicines Agency (EMA) and regional oncology consortiums has facilitated technology adoption across Germany, France, and the U.K. Germany, in particular, serves as a manufacturing hub for radiation oncology equipment, benefitting from domestic R&D incentives and regional export strength. The European cancer burden—projected to exceed 4 million new cases annually by 2030—continues to drive government funding and public-private partnerships aimed at modernizing cancer care. Regional manufacturers are expanding production facilities for mobile IORT systems, addressing demand for flexible, intra-surgical radiation procedures in both large hospital networks and specialized oncology centers.

Meanwhile, Asia Pacific is emerging as the fastest-growing region, with healthcare modernization and rising awareness of precision oncology treatments driving robust adoption. China and India are implementing national cancer control programs emphasizing early detection and localized radiation therapy solutions. The World Health Organization’s regional data highlights an upward trajectory in cancer prevalence, particularly in breast and gynecological cancers, aligning with the region’s investment in advanced surgical radiotherapy equipment. Asia’s cross-border supply chains for medical devices are improving through increased local production and regulatory harmonization, making high-end IORT systems more accessible to secondary cities.

Overall, regional market penetration strategies now emphasize localized production, after-sales service infrastructure, and training for oncology specialists to maximize operational efficiency. Despite high capital costs and procedural complexity, global initiatives in healthcare digitization and government-led oncology programs continue to support steady market expansion. The convergence of radiation precision technologies, machine learning–assisted planning systems, and hybrid surgical radiotherapy units positions the IORT segment as a core pillar in the future of minimally invasive cancer care.
